Types of Fargo North Dakota Complaint for Personal Injury for Pedestrian by Car in Parking Lot: 1. Negligence Claims: This type of complaint is based on the driver's failure to exercise reasonable care, resulting in the accident. Negligent actions may involve distractions, speeding, failure to yield, or disregard for traffic laws in the parking lot. 2. Premises Liability Claims: If the accident occurred due to inadequate maintenance or dangerous conditions in the parking lot, victims can file a premises' liability claim. This includes hazards such as poorly designed parking lots, inadequate signage, poorly lit areas, or lack of pedestrian crossings. A complaint must typically contain three essential elements: a statement of jurisdiction, the facts of the case, and a demand for relief. In the context of a Fargo North Dakota Complaint for Personal Injury for Pedestrian by Car in Parking Lot, make sure to cite the appropriate jurisdiction and detail how the accident occurred. Clearly articulate what compensation you are pursuing to ensure your complaint is comprehensive.
